Question : Delegwiz deny mod?
I'm customizing the Delegwiz.inf file and am not finding any way to deny permissions. For example, to deny the deletion of a top level Organizational Unit to a specific group.
None of my docs explained how to do this. Does it exist? Below is an example of how to allow certain rights
[template14]
AppliesToClasses=domainDNS
,organizat
ionalUnit
Description = "Create an Organizational Unit"
ObjectTypes = SCOPE
[template14.SCOPE]
organizationalUnit=CC
Answer : Delegwiz deny mod?
The delegation wizard is used for delegating allowed permissions.
To deny permission, use the Security tab in the properties of the OU.
To see the Security-tab in the properties dialog, you nead to enable the View|'Advanced Features' option in ADUC
